Using the following information, prepare a factory overhead flexible budget for Jacob Company where the total factory overhead cost is $206,500 at normal capacity (100%). Include capacity at 60%, 80%, 100%, and 120%. Total variable cost is $15.25 per unit and total fixed costs are $54,000. The information is for month ended October 31. (Hint: Determine units produced at normal capacity.)
